
Citrus and Coconut Pie is a delightful and refreshing dessert that combines the tangy zest of citrus with the rich, tropical flavor of coconut. This pie is perfect for any occasion, be it a summer family gathering or a cozy winter dinner. Follow this recipe to create a pie that boasts a perfect balance of sweetness and tartness, along with a creamy, nutty texture from almonds and coconut.
-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ature before you begin, as this helps with better mixing and a smoother batter.
- Toast the almonds lightly before using them to enhance their flavor and add a bit of crunch to the pie.
- For an extra citrusy kick, add some finely grated orange zest to the batter.
- Use freshly squeezed orange juice for a more natural and vibrant flavor.
- Check for doneness by inserting a toothpick into the center of the pie; it should come out clean or with a few crumbs attached.
- Allow the pie to cool completely before slicing to ensure it holds its shape.
- Serve chilled or at room temperature to experience the full burst of citrus and coconut flavors.
